Research Abstract

Ultramafic and mafic inclusions from the Northeast Japan Arc, Izu-Ogasawara Arc and Fossa Magna Region were studied. Based on their mineral chemistries, most of them are interpreted to be cumulates from arc tholeiite, formed in magma chambers at the depth near the crust-mantle boundary. Some amphibole-poor ultramafic and mafic xenoliths from the lchinomegata maar ejecta and the Miocene Ogi basalt, however, are the cumulates formed by crystallization of oceanic tholeiite. Clinopyroxenites from the lchinomegata maar and olivine gabbro from the Miocene Atsumi dolerite are crystallized from alkali basalt magmas. Gabbronorites from the Fuji volcano and the Yatsugatake volcano are cumulates from dacitic magmas mixed with basaltic magmas. Sr isotope ratios of the inclusions from the Pliocene volcanics in Sanogawa area are low (0.7031-33), and able to be characterized as the products of back-arc magmatism in the Ancient Izu-Shichitou Arc. Some gabbroic inclusions from the Yatsugatake volcano have low Sr isotopic ratios (<0.7040) significant of the Izu=ogasawara arc volcanoes, and the others show high ivalues (>0.7040) significant of frontal volcanos in the Northeast Japan Arc. Sr isotope ratios of the most gabbroic inclusions from the Atsumi dolerite show low values (0.7032-33), but some olivine gabbros show high values (0.7038-39). Useful isochron ages are only determined for inclusions from the Atsumi area by Sm-Nd method. The ages are from 28 to 32 Ma for the olivine gabbros and 54 to 66 Ma for gabbros.
